Depopulation, Decline and Transformation. The Municipality of Santiago, 1930-1990. Relevant Information
This paper deals with the process of lost of residents, deterioration and use change undergone by the Santiago commune between 1930 and 1990, stressing the fact that Karl Brunner (Urbanist from Vienna) knew about this phenomena the 30's when this process was in its first stages of development.
